MISCIBLE POLYMER BLENDS .1. THERMODYNAMICS OF THE BLEND MELTS POLY(METHYL METHACRYLATE) POLY(ETHYLENE OXIDE) AND POLY(METHYL METHACRYLATE) POLY(VINYLIDENE FLUORIDE)

The composition, temperature and pressure dependences of thermodynamic characteristics have been studied for the melts of blends of poly(methyl methacrylate) (PMMA) with poly(ethylene oxide) (PEO) and poly(vinylidene fluoride) (PVDF). The experimental data have been treated in terms of the Sanchez-Lacombe equation of state, and the parameter X12 has been calculated. In addition, the SAXS patterns of these blends have been examined above the melting temperature (Tm) for PEO and PVDF. © 1990.
